| Title: National Institutes of Health Construction Grants | |
| Abstract: The National Institutes of Health (NIH) proposes to review and/or amend the existing regulations at 42 CFR 52b governing grants awarded by the agency and its components for construction of new buildings and the alteration, renovation, remodeling, improvement, expansion, and repair of existing buildings, including the provision of equipment necessary to make the building (or applicable part of the building) suitable for which it was constructed. The NIH proposes to revise and/or amend the regulations to promote consistency with the Department of Health and Human Services (HHS) regulations at 45 CFR 74 applicable to recovery and insurance coverage. Specifically, NIH proposes to replace language in section 52b.9(a)(1) with the language in 45 CFR 74.32(c)(2), and replace the language in section 52b.10(n) with the language in 45 CFR 74.31. The narrative in section 52b.12(b) that refers to the National Cancer Institute having copies of certain resource documents would be updated. Citations in section 52b.12(c) design and construction standards would be updated. Section 52b.14(c) would be amended to reference Executive Order 12372, Intergovernmental Review of Federal Programs. Reference numbers (1), (3), (4), (5), (6), and (7) in section 53b.14(d) Policies would be updated. | |
